Data Retention Policy

Last updated 20 June 2026

This policy explains how long CarJio keeps different kinds of data and when each is deleted. We keep data only as long as we need it to run a trustworthy marketplace, meet legal obligations and resolve disputes.

Principles

We retain the minimum data necessary, for the shortest reasonable time. Retention periods balance your privacy against fraud prevention, safety and our legal obligations under applicable Indian law.

How long we keep things

DataRetention
Account and profileWhile your account is active; deleted on account closure.
Active listings and their mediaWhile the listing is live on the marketplace.
Sold, removed or rejected listings and mediaRetained for up to 24 months for fraud prevention and dispute resolution, then deleted.
Verification documents (RC, insurance, service records)Kept in a private bucket while the listing is active and for a limited period after, then deleted. Never shown to buyers.
Registration numberStored privately for the life of the listing; visible only to the owner and admins, never to buyers.
Leads and enquiriesRetained while relevant to the seller and buyer, typically up to 24 months.
Privacy-light analytics eventsAppend-only and read only in aggregate; retained for trend analysis and pruned periodically.
Moderation and audit logsRetained longer for accountability and safety, as permitted by law.

Deletion and your choices

You can delete your listings and edit your profile at any time from your account. To delete your account and the personal data associated with it, email privacy@carjio.com. Some records may be retained after deletion where the law requires it or to resolve an active dispute or fraud investigation; once that need passes, they are deleted.

Backups

Deleted data may persist in encrypted backups for a short period until those backups rotate out, after which it is permanently removed.
